UDINE, Italy -- Udinese scraped a narrow 1-0 win at home to Genoa in the
Italian league, and needed the help of an own goal to do so.
The home side dominated possession Tuesday and had the better of the
chances but struggled to really test Genoa goalkeeper Mattia Perin.
The deadlock was broken 11 minutes from time when Emanuele Calaio headed
Antonio Di Natales free kick into his own net.
Di Natale thought he had scored in the first half but the Udinese
captains effort was ruled offside.
Udinese extended its unbeaten home run in the league to 21 games.
Both teams had been level on four points but Udineses second win of the
campaign moved it provisionally into the top half of the table -- ahead
of the other midweek fixtures.

over the Lakers on Friday.SAN FRANCISCO - Jonathan Martin is back on
the Stanford campus hanging out and working out with old college pals
turned successful pros, Andrew Luck and Richard Sherman.
He has returned to his Bay Area comfort zone, far from South Florida and
his short-lived, tumultuous tenure with the Dolphins. Now, hes here to
stay.
Martin is the newest member of the San Francisco 49ers, and hes thrilled
for a fresh start to keep playing football. And for anyone who
questions why the offensive lineman couldnt tough things out through a
bullying scandal in Miami, hes unconcerned.
"You could say this or that could have gone differently. Hindsight is
20-20," Martin said Thursday upon passing a physical. "My focus is 100
per cent on the future, moving forward."
In recent months, Martin has learned to ignore all the negative chatter
and surround himself with those who have been so supportive along the
way.
Already, starting 49ers offensive linemen Joe Staley and Anthony Davis
have reached out.
"I can tell already that Im going to get along just great with those
guys," Martin said. "Ive felt a warm welcome from the entire 49ers
community, fan base, coaching staff, everybody. Im just looking forward
to the future and getting back to playing football."
Martins trade from the Dolphins to the Niners became official Thursday.
It reunites him with his college coach, Jim Harbaugh. The teams first
announced the move Tuesday night for Martin, who left the Dolphins last
fall after accusing teammate Richie Incognito of bullying in a scandal
that overshadowed the franchises 8-8 season.
An investigation for the NFL determined last month that Incognito and
two other offensive linemen engaged in persistent harassment of Martin,
another offensive lineman and an assistant trainer. After Martins
departure from the Dolphins in late October, he underwent counselling
for emotional issues. Incognito was suspended for the final eight games.
"Any time we acquire a player we give him a clean slate, along with
every opportunity to demonstrate his value to our organization, both on
the field and in the community," 49ers general manager Trent Baalke
said. "It will be no different in Jonathans case. As a former Stanford
student-athlete, we are very familiar with Jonathan and look forward to
working with him."
Harbaugh has supported Martin all along, from his early college days at
Stanford to the offensive linemans departure from the Dolphins, and even
in a formal NFL investigation into the situation in Miami. Harbaugh
spoke publicly about Martin in November and referred to him as a
&"personal friend.dddddddddddd"
"Hes a stand-up guy. It means a lot when somebody with that much
credibility has your back," Martin said. "His enthusiasm is infectious.
You can see it at every level of the organization. It rubs off on
everybody. Just to be around a winning atmosphere, a coach thats focused
on winning, its really the best situation I could have asked for."
Now, these two will begin the process of getting Martin up to speed in a
hurry this off-season. Harbaugh has said hes not concerned because it
should be a smooth transition. Martin already knows many of the coaches
who came from Stanford when Harbaugh was hired in January 2011. Harbaugh
has credited Martin for being a "very intelligent football player" who
has familiarity with the Niners system.
Martin noted he never considered retiring, saying: "That didnt even
cross my mind at any point. Im a football player, Ive been a football
player my whole life."
"The way Im approaching it, I have to earn my spot on this team, Im a
new guy in the locker room," Martin said. "Its a blank slate for me. Im
looking forward to revitalizing my career, getting back to playing. I
want to do whatever I can to contribute to this O-line. Its one of the
best O-lines in football already."
The 24-year-old Martin wasnt expected to return to Miami, and owner
Stephen Ross made it known in January that the 2012 second-round pick
would likely be gone.
The investigation found a pattern of harassment on the Dolphins, with
Martin the primary target of vicious taunts and racist insults that
occurred almost daily. The report said teammates threatened to rape
Martins sister, called him a long list of slurs and bullied him for not
being "black enough." Martin is black and Incognito is white.
Now, Martin can truly move forward in a new jersey, and perhaps in a new
number � even in a new stadium. The 49ers will play their first season
in Levis Stadium at team headquarters this year.
Martin said they have always had a great relationship, from the days
Harbaugh recruited him to Stanford and coached him for three years with
the Cardinal.
"The goal for this transaction is a win-win," Harbaugh said.
Martin, too, considers this a perfect fit, with the opportunity to chase
a championship an added bonus.
"Absolutely," Martin said. "I think it worked out great, once again
playing for Coach Harbaugh, once again in the Bay Area. Playing for a
winning franchise, a team thats had a lot of recent success. Hopefully
Ill be able to contribute to further success with this team."
